Understanding the Wheel and Probability Distribution

At the heart of crazy time lies a spinning wheel divided into various segments, each associated with a different payout value. These segments include numbers 1, 2, 5, and 10, along with four bonus games: Crazy Time, Cash Hunt, Coin Flip, and Pachinko. The payout for landing on a numbered segment corresponds directly to the number itself. The real excitement, however, comes from the bonus games, which offer the potential for significantly higher multipliers. Understanding the probability distribution of each segment is fundamental to developing an effective strategy. The numbers 1, 2, and 5 have a higher probability of appearing on the wheel, making them statistically more likely outcomes. However, they also offer the lowest payouts.

Conversely, the segments triggering the bonus games are less frequent but offer the opportunity for substantial wins. The Crazy Time bonus, with its potential for multipliers up to 20,000x, is the most coveted, but also the hardest to trigger. It's crucial to recognize that the Return to Player (RTP) of crazy time is around 96.08%, meaning that, on average, the game returns 96.08% of all wagered money to players over the long term. This doesn’t guarantee individual wins, but it indicates the fairness of the game. Players need to be aware that the house always has an edge, and responsible gambling is paramount. A robust understanding of these probabilities forms the cornerstone of any consistent winning strategy.

Leveraging Bonus Game Strategies

When a bonus game is triggered, a new set of strategic considerations comes into play. Each bonus game – Cash Hunt, Coin Flip, Pachinko, and Crazy Time – has its unique mechanics and optimal approaches. In Cash Hunt, the goal is to select a hidden prize from a grid of tiles. Experienced players often look for patterns or clusters of higher-value prizes, but ultimately, it remains a game of chance. Coin Flip offers a 50/50 chance of winning a multiplier, with the potential for increasing multipliers on subsequent flips. Players need to decide when to cash out and secure their winnings, or risk losing everything by continuing to flip. Pachinko involves dropping a puck into a grid of pegs, with the puck bouncing around before landing in a prize slot. Predicting the puck’s trajectory is impossible, but some players focus on slots with higher potential payouts.

The Crazy Time bonus is the most complex and potentially rewarding. A top slot spins, awarding multipliers to different colored flippers. The puck then travels around the wheel, landing on a flippers and applying the multiplier. Players need to carefully assess the potential multipliers and the likelihood of the puck landing on a particular flipper. Understanding the mechanics of each bonus game and developing a strategy for maximizing your winnings is essential for long-term success. It’s also important to remember that bonus games are relatively infrequent, so you shouldn’t rely on them as your primary source of profit.
